This Oral History Project has been successfully concluded!

You have seen our web page extracts. You may have seen the www.bbc.co.uk/Legacies using material from our archive regarding Work in Bedfordshire.

Some of the recurring themes touched on in the conversations are:
· Life in the villages of Marston Vale over the last 100 years
· The rise and decline of the brick works
· Farming & market gardening
· Childhood & adolescence,
· Life here during the Second World War
· The experience of immigrants
· and a lots more …….
